Why an Ice Fishing Rod Holder Is Necessary
I’ve learned that an ice fishing rod holder is not just a convenience—it’s something I truly rely on when I’m out on the ice. When I set my rod in a holder, I can keep my hands free to drill another hole, check my line, or simply stay comfortable in the cold. It makes my fishing setup much more organized and helps me focus better on the overall experience instead of constantly holding the rod.
My rod holder also helps me react more effectively to bites. Instead of gripping the rod the entire time, I can watch for movement and still be ready when a fish strikes. It reduces fatigue during long hours on the ice and gives my rod a stable position, which is especially useful when I’m using tip-ups or waiting patiently for action. For me, that stability can make a big difference in both comfort and success.
I also appreciate how a rod holder protects my gear. It keeps my rod from sliding on the ice, getting wet, or being accidentally knocked over. In freezing conditions, that extra support matters more than people think. From my experience, having a good ice fishing rod holder makes the whole trip easier, safer, and more productive.

What I Look for in Stability
The first thing I check is how stable the rod holder is on ice. I prefer a model that can anchor securely and resist tipping when a fish bites or the wind picks up. If the holder wobbles too much, I know it can affect my setup and make fishing more frustrating.
Material and Durability Matter to Me
Since ice fishing means freezing temperatures and rough conditions, I want a rod holder made from durable materials. I usually look for strong metal or high-quality cold-resistant plastic. I avoid anything that feels flimsy because I know it may crack or bend after repeated use.
Adjustability Is a Big Plus
I like rod holders that let me adjust the angle and position of my rod. This helps me set up for different fishing styles and changing conditions. When I can fine-tune the angle, I feel more in control of my gear and can react better when a fish strikes.
Portability Helps Me a Lot
Since I often move from one spot to another, I prefer a rod holder that is lightweight and easy to carry. A foldable or compact design makes my trips much easier. If it fits easily into my sled or gear bag, I know it will be practical for regular use.
Compatibility with My Fishing Rod
I always make sure the rod holder fits my fishing rod properly. Some holders work better with certain rod sizes or handle styles, so I check compatibility before buying. A snug and secure fit gives me confidence that my rod will stay in place.
Ease of Use in Cold Weather
In freezing weather, I want equipment that is simple to set up and operate with gloves on. I look for a rod holder that doesn’t require complicated adjustments or tiny parts. The easier it is to use, the more I enjoy my time on the ice.
Extra Features I Appreciate
Sometimes I find extra features that make a rod holder even better. I like built-in tip-up support, smooth rotation, or added visibility in low light. These small details may not seem important at first, but they can improve my overall fishing experience.
